Dawn PaaS 基于 Docker 的 PaaS 系统

程序名称:Dawn PaaS

授权协议: 未知

操作系统: Linux

开发语言: Ruby

Dawn PaaS 介绍

Dawn 是一个基于 Docker 的 PaaS 系统,使用 Ruby 开发。实现了类 Heroku 的接口。该项目是在
2013年10月 开始的,原本计划是作为商业服务发布,但由于 PaaS 市场的竞争越来越激烈,因此决定开源。

当前开发的版本是基于 Ubuntu 14.04,运行了 docker, ruby 2.1.2 (rails 4.1.1), postgresql,
redis, logplex 和 hipache.

将来的目标是将平台移植到 CoreOS 上,并将应用放置到不同的容器上,以便更加模块化,同时更加容易发布。

特性:

  • 通过 Git 将应用发布到平台

  • 使用 Buildstep 构建应用容器

  • 可导入环境变量到应用空间

  • 可通过 HTTP POST 来获取应用日志

  • per-proctype 实现伸缩

要求

  • 支持 AMD64 虚拟机

  • Vagrant >= 1.6.2

  • Ansible >= 1.6.2

  • 耐心

Dawn PaaS 官网

https://github.com/dawn/dawn

相关编程语言

Cyclone是一个打造容器工作流的云原生持续集成持续发...
Kui Shell 为构建云原生应用程序提供了新的开发经验...
Eclipse MicroProfile 是一个 Java 微服务开发的基础...
Kabanero 构建在 Knative、Istio 与 Tekton 之上,提...
Antrea 是一个 Kubernetes 网络解决方案,旨在实现 ...
Linkerd 是一个提供弹性云端原生应用服务网格(serv...